The University of Kentucky men’s basketball program has added Brian Long and Sam Malone as walk-ons for the 2011-12 season.

Long is the younger brother of Travis Long, who played a season under John Calipari at Memphis. Long is a point guard who [URL=”http://www.northjersey.com/sports/83743887_Dad_s_3-guard_offense.html”][COLOR=#0d1db8]played high school basketball[/COLOR][/URL] for his father, head coach Brian Long, at River Dell High School in New Jersey.
Malone is a point guard from Scituate, Massachusetts.
